



I'm Mai A., the breeder behind YorkTown California Biewers located in California. We are a small hobby breeder located in Sunny SoCal, we breed for health and temperament primarily. Our dogs are raised and live 24/7 inside our home as our family pets, not raised in a barn, kennel or farm. We follow breed standards and thrive to produce the best Biewer Terriers. Our dogs are imported from Europe and South America from the FCI registry. They are DNA tested here in the USA for breed certification, health, traits and AKC parentage. Our Biewers have double registry, AKC and BTRA ( Biewer Terrier Registry of America). They also are OFA/CHIC certified to meet the basic health screening requirements recommended by the breed’s parent club. We have a VERY small number of litters available yearly. Eye Examination (rDVM, not registered with OFA)
Eye testing reduces the chance of passing down a wide range of hereditary eye illnesses including retinal dysplasia, lens luxation, and glaucoma, which can cause impared vision or blindness.
Patellar Luxation
Knee testing reduces the chance of passing down Patellar Luxation, which results in the kneecap becoming displaced or dislocated and can cause mild to severe joint pain.
